The story

AIICO is a 60+ year old Nigerian composite insurer (life + non-life) that has expanded into a broader financial services group over the past decade — spinning up AIICO Capital (investment management, 2012) and AIICO Capital Finance (consumer/SME lending, annuity-backed loans). Its embedded-finance angle is 'embedded insurance': it has publicly stated a strategy of embedding insurance into partner distribution (e.g. Coscharis for auto), and its developer portal (docs.aiicoplc.com) exposes REST APIs for motor, travel, personal accident, home content, shop content, domestic travel, and life payments so partners can sell AIICO cover from their own channels.

Product timeline
1963
Founded as an insurance company in Nigeria· founding
1970
IPO on the Nigerian Stock Exchange· ipo
2012
AIICO Capital Limited established as investment management subsidiary· expansion
2021
Partnership with Coscharis Motors to embed insurance into automobile sales· partnership
2025
AIICO Capital Credit & Finance Limited launched to offer consumer/SME loans· lending
2026
Retained composite insurance licence from NAICOM without capital raise; declared ₦4.39bn dividend at AGM· regulatory
2026
Unveiled refreshed brand identity· rebrand
